Cold and Flu Season
The season of sniffles is fast approaching, and I want to remind everyone about the importance of practicing good hygiene at school. Please encourage your children to wash their hands and/or use hand sanitizer frequently, use tissues when sneezing, coughing, or blowing their noses, and keep their hands to themselves. 

If your children are showing symptoms of a cold or flu including: runny nose, sneezing, coughing, sore throat, congestion, headache, or fatigue PLEASE KEEP THEM AT HOME!
Students are often irritable and distracted when not feeling well, so they will not be able to participate fully and are at risk of infecting other students (and teachers!).
